US Regulators Recognize XRP’s Non-Security Status in SEC, CFTC Landmark Crypto RulesXRP gains clearer regulatory footing as U.S. authorities explicitly include it among digital commodities in new SEC guidance, aligning it with major crypto assets like bitcoin and ether while reinforcing a shift toward function-based oversight that could reshape how investors evaluate risk, value drivers, and long-term market positioning.
